The Role of Eco-Friendly Backing Paper in Adhesive Production

Introduction

The adhesive industry is facing increasing pressure to adopt sustainable practices. One way manufacturers are contributing to this shift is through the use of eco-friendly backing papers. These backing papers, often made from biodegradable and recyclable materials, play a crucial role in reducing the environmental impact of adhesive products. In this article, we will explore the advantages of using eco-friendly backing paper in adhesive production and its growing role in promoting sustainability.

1. Reduced Environmental Impact

Eco-friendly backing paper is made from sustainable materials, such as recycled paper or biodegradable substances. By using these materials, manufacturers can reduce the environmental footprint of their products. These backing papers help minimize the waste generated during production and contribute to a more sustainable lifecycle for adhesive products.

With increasing demand for greener solutions, eco-friendly backing paper has become an essential component in the drive towards reducing overall waste and conserving resources in the adhesive manufacturing process.

2. Support for Recyclable Materials

One of the key benefits of eco-friendly backing paper is that it is often fully recyclable. This means that after the adhesive is used, the backing paper can be processed and reused, reducing the need for virgin materials and helping to close the recycling loop. By integrating recyclable backing papers into production, manufacturers contribute to a circular economy where resources are reused rather than discarded.

Many eco-conscious manufacturers are now prioritizing recyclable backing paper as part of their sustainability efforts, promoting environmentally responsible practices throughout the production process.

3. Eco-Friendly Production Methods

In addition to using sustainable materials for the backing paper, the production processes themselves are also being adapted to be more environmentally friendly. Manufacturers are employing energy-efficient production methods, reducing the use of toxic chemicals, and minimizing water consumption during the production of eco-friendly backing paper. These practices align with global sustainability goals and help reduce the overall environmental impact of adhesive products.

4. Market Demand for Sustainable Products

As consumers and businesses become more eco-conscious, the demand for sustainable products has increased significantly. In industries such as packaging, automotive, and electronics, where adhesives are crucial, there is a growing preference for products made with eco-friendly backing paper. By offering sustainable products, manufacturers can meet this demand and appeal to environmentally-conscious consumers and businesses.

As a result, eco-friendly backing paper has become a selling point for manufacturers looking to distinguish their products in a competitive market.

5. Long-Term Economic Benefits

While eco-friendly materials can sometimes be more expensive upfront, they can lead to long-term cost savings by reducing waste, minimizing the use of raw materials, and increasing the efficiency of the production process. By adopting eco-friendly backing paper, manufacturers can improve operational efficiency and reduce costs associated with waste management and resource depletion.
